Psychiatrists are medical doctors who specialise in the diagnosis and treatment of psychological health conditions. They can prescribe medication and deal psychiatric therapy to assist patients handle their signs. They can also refer you to other healthcare experts, such as therapists and nutritional experts, for more extensive care. They work carefully with GPs to offer integrated take care of their patients.

You can find a psychiatrist near you by asking your GP for a referral or searching online. Some websites list private psychiatrists by location and specialty, making it easy to find one that matches your needs. Others have a chat function that lets you talk with a psychiatrist via video or text. This is useful if you are too distressed to take a trip or can't go to an in-person appointment.

When you've found a psychiatrist you're comfortable with, you can schedule an appointment. Throughout this time, the psychiatrist will consider your medical history and evaluate your mindset. They will then create a treatment strategy, which may include a combination of therapy and medicine. The psychiatrist will likewise be able to recommend extra tests or specialists, depending upon your condition.

Psychiatrists are highly trained to identify and deal with psychological health conditions, consisting of depression, bipolar illness, schizophrenia, anxiety, panic condition, OCD, and consuming conditions. They are also able to prescribe medication, which is something that not all mental health experts can do. In addition, psychiatrists are able to prescribe long-lasting medications and can monitor the impacts of these medications on your body.

When selecting a psychiatrist, think about whether they are on the GMC's specialist register. This means that they are certified to practice in the UK and have been trained to treat mental health conditions. They must likewise pass regular assessments to maintain their licence.

Psychiatrists are medically certified physicians with specialist training in the assessment, identification, treatment and avoidance of psychological health issue. They look at how the mind and body effect on one another and may prescribe medication in addition to advise other treatments such as psychotherapy. You can inspect a psychiatrist's qualifications by taking a look at the medical register. If their name has the letters MRCPsych after it, this means they are a member of the Royal College of Psychiatrists.
